Output d37efce80fb6a24354105bd21eb3eee9cd2ec37cbcbd901af434b30f0299e7c8:0

value
2222618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 003780a64c492a91c27e4db7e7fdd4b8fdce9d95 OP_EQUAL
address
31iAQvkvZKVvqsfJvNTeryaJP59vsS8CBx
transaction
d37efce80fb6a24354105bd21eb3eee9cd2ec37cbcbd901af434b30f0299e7c8
spent
true